The Air Jordan 1 Low OG is a perfect entry point. It's low-key but recognizable. Not for performance players or comfort chasers. It's a fashion piece—a really good one. For $130, it's a reasonable price for a design that never goes out of style. Let's talk about the silhouette on camera - the Air Jordan 1 Low OG profile is "chef's kiss". It's chunkier than some modern lows, which I personally prefer. On-foot feel is classic: minimal cushion, direct connection to the ground. The advantage? That timeless style is unbeatable. The disadvantage? Your feet might get tired on long walks. I'd recommend this to sneakerheads who appreciate the original design language. If comfort is your #1 priority, there are better options out there, period. On foot, the "Air Jordan 1 Low OG" just looks "right". The profile is sleek—it doesn't feel bulky at all. I've worn it for a full day, and while it's not a "comfort" shoe, it's never painful. If you're used to modern tech, the firm midsole might feel dated... but for style? Unbeatable. Final thoughts on the "Air Jordan 1 Low OG". After wearing these for a week, they've broken in nicely. The simplicity is its strength & its weakness. You get a legendary silhouette that works with almost any fit, but you don't get modern comfort innovations. At around $120-$140 USD, you're buying into the Jordan Brand legacy. If you want a reliable, stylish low-top from the Jordan series, this is a fantastic choice. If your main concern is advanced cushioning or support, you might want to explore other options. For me, it's a wardrobe essential.
